What is Sash Window Refitting?
Sash window refitting is the procedure of fixing, replacing, or rejuvenating existing sash windows to improve their performance and extend their life expectancy. This can involve various tasks, such as:
| Task | Description |
|---|---|
| Fixing wood frames | Fixing rot, damage, or warping to ensure structural integrity. |
| Changing or bring back glass | Upgrading damaged, cloudy, or inefficient glass with new glazing choices. |
| Setting up draught proofing | Adding seals and strips to avoid air leakages and boost energy efficiency. |
| Painting and finishing | Repainting and sealing wooden elements to secure versus weathering. |
| Updating hardware | Replacing or reconditioning locks, wheels, and weights for much better performance. |
By concentrating on these elements, sash window refitting can drastically enhance the aesthetic worth and energy efficiency of a home.

Typical FAQs About Sash Window Refitting
What is the typical cost of refitting sash windows?
The cost of refitting sash windows can differ substantially based upon various elements, consisting of the condition of the windows, the degree of the work required, and local labor costs. On average, homeowners can anticipate to pay between ₤ 800 to ₤ 1,500 per window.
The length of time does the refitting procedure take?
The time required for sash window refitting depends upon the scope of work. Minor repair work might take a few hours, while more substantial refitting could take a number of days to weeks.
Can I refit sash windows myself?
While some minor repair jobs can be done as DIY jobs, sash window refitting frequently needs specialized skills and tools. Working with an expert is recommended for finest outcomes, especially for older or more delicate windows.
Exist any grants readily available for refitting historic windows?
Some regional governments and heritage companies might use grants or financial help for homeowners aiming to protect historic functions, consisting of sash windows. Research your regional choices for possible funding.
How can I keep my sash windows post-refitting?
Regular upkeep can extend the life of your sash windows. Here are a few suggestions:
- Inspect seals and weather stripping each year.
- Clean the tracks and moving systems to guarantee smooth operation.
- Repaint or refinish wood frames every couple of years.
- Screen for any indications of rot or damage and resolve them promptly.
